Gambaraan Faal Paru Petugas Pengisi Bahan Bakar Di Spbu Jalan Arifin Ahmad Dan Jalan Tuanku Tambusai Kota Pekanbaru
Gas station is public infrastructure from PT. Pertamina to fulfill people’s need of gasoline. Gasoline is a mixture of more than 500 volatile hydrocarbon compounds. Most concerned hydrocarbon compounds in research on health problems due to exposure to gasoline is benzene. Inhalation of benzene 300 ppm for 7 days could induce apoptosis changes in lung parenchyma. One of the gas station workers who are often exposed to benzene are the petrol filling workers. Gas station in Tuanku Tambusai street and Arifin Ahmad street Pekanbaru have been established for a long time and located on the main road. This study was a descriptive study that aims to describe pulmonary function of petrol filling workers in 2016. The sample in this study were 34 petrol filling workers. The result showed that 4 petrol filling workers (12%) had impaired lung function, consist of 3 peoples (9%) had obstructive pulmonary disorders and 1 people (3%) had restrictive pulmonary disorder. Most petrol filling worker diagnosed with impaired lung function were the petrol filling worker that aged 25-30 years, female gender, normal nutritional status, with work length >3 years, non smoker, and petrol filling worker who did not use mask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) in the workplace.
